Nigeria, March 6 -- The Kwara State government has reaffirmed its commitment to promoting local content and strengthening indigenous institutions across the State.
The General Manager of the Kwara State Public Procurement Agency, QS Raheem AbdulBaki, stated this during a courtesy visit to the Kwara State Printing and Publishing Agency, publishers of "The Herald Newspapers".
AbdulBaki, who described The Herald as a key legacy of the State that must be preserved and promoted, also emphasised the Agency's responsibility in monitoring local content performance-an area where he noted significant progress.
